Overview of Atlantis V2
Atlantis V2 is a versatile game engine designed for fast-paced multiplayer games. It offers robust networking capabilities, real-time physics, and easy integration with popular development tools. Its modular architecture allows developers to customize and optimize their games efficiently.
Use Case Recommendations for Atlantis V2
First-Person Shooters (FPS)
Atlantis V2 excels in FPS development due to its low-latency networking and high-performance rendering. It supports complex physics simulations and detailed environments, making it suitable for competitive and immersive FPS titles.
Multiplayer Online Battle Arena (MOBA)
For MOBA games, Atlantis V2’s scalability and real-time synchronization are beneficial. Its ability to handle numerous concurrent players with minimal lag makes it a strong candidate for large-scale multiplayer battles.
Competitors to Consider
Unity
Unity is widely used for both FPS and MOBA games due to its user-friendly interface, extensive asset store, and strong community support. It offers cross-platform deployment and a variety of plugins to enhance development.
Unreal Engine
Unreal Engine is renowned for its high-fidelity graphics and powerful Blueprint visual scripting system. It is ideal for AAA-quality FPS games and complex multiplayer environments, providing advanced networking features.
Factors to Consider When Choosing a Platform
- Performance requirements
- Target platforms (PC, consoles, mobile)
- Development team expertise
- Budget constraints
- Community and support resources
Assessing these factors will help determine whether Atlantis V2 or a competitor best suits your project’s needs for FPS, MOBA, or other multiplayer game genres.
